MEMO — Project Tindral Delay

For the incoming director: Project Tindral, our internal reporting platform, is now eight weeks behind schedule due to integration issues with the Vexley data layer. The revised completion date is end of Q2. Resourcing is unchanged. Before your first steering meeting, please review the following.

board note of kagep-yahig: Only 9 of the 120 pilot accounts renewed Quenix, so a churn review is set for April 1.

## Step 4: Update token refresh handling

Quornix 3.2 fixes the session-token refresh bug where plugins received a stale token after the 15-minute rotation window. Plugins must now call the refresh hook instead of caching tokens locally. Remove any manual expiry math; the runtime handles rotation. Plugins that cache tokens will be rejected at load time starting next minor release. Test against the sandbox gateway before publishing. Set your plugin manifest to match the values below.

settings of fafog-haduf:
ZORIX_PIN=4648
ZORIX_METRICS_HOST=metrics.zorix.paliqsys.corp
ZORIX_LOG_LEVEL=info
ZORIX_TENANT=druix

**Ticket #DRIFT — Catalogue import acting weird on staging**

Hey, welcome aboard! Quick one for you: the Shelfwing catalogue importer on staging is pulling different field mappings than prod, so new titles land without subject tags. Pretty sure someone hand-edited staging months ago and it drifted from what's in the repo. Can you diff and realign? For reference, here's what the importer is currently running with.

settings of kafof-kaduf:
QUENAX_LOG_LEVEL=info
QUENAX_METRICS_HOST=metrics.quenax.tolvaqcorp.corp
QUENAX_POOL_SIZE=4